Back-to-back houses not to be erected without permis- sion.—Notwithstanding anything contained in any other law for the time being in force, no person shall, without the previous permission of the Health Officer, erect any back-to-back houses intended to be used as dwelling houses and any such house the erection of which is begun after the commencement of this Act without such permission shall be deemed to be unfit for human habitation within the meaning of Section 102.
